Jon Bois, one of the excellent minds at Secret Base, joins Ryan Nanni to talk about a very particular NFL statistical quirk. Namely: the Chicago Bears are the only franchise to never have a quarterback throw for 4,000 yards. Why is this milestone appealing? What does it actually mean to break through it? Which passers have kept other teams from joining the Bears on this list? And why should Raiders fans get free NFL Sunday Ticket next season?
